The performance you have is indeed not so good. First the -s 200000 is too low I think. I got poor performance every time I set lower than 500000. I'm usually using 2000000.
Regarding to PPS I rarely using as a reference. First I'm checking the 4ch/h and I'm trying to tune to max. Then based on longer test period I try to go for maxing out 5ch/h or 6ch/h, depending how fast is the computer. on a slow machine 6ch/h  must be measured for too long time to overcome the random factor.
The startup tuning works well with higher sieve size and higher SievePercentage. No wonder that it's odd for -s 200000 -d 16.
Those two accounts you mentioned (unfortunately) doesn't belongs to me as I also write in one of my previous post. Regarding to hardware I use i7 3770 for development and I've just started some testing on AMD Opteron 4180 which meantime doesn't performs so well. I expected much more per core.

Hi,
A minor release to fix some of the problems we encountered lately and some features mostly for advanced users. As usual this version is not well tested, (time issue). The source is on github.
1. Implemented some kind of heartbeat monitoring, if a thread get stuck it's automatically restarted. Hopefully this will resolve the problem some of you reported that after a while the mining speed is dropped.
2. By default the initial cache auto tuning is disabled. It can be enabled using the "-tune true" command line parameter or by pressing the 'c' button in the miner.
3. The size of L1CacheElements that the above mentioned auto tuning used to set, is by default 256000 and can be set using the '-c' parameter (must be between 64000 - 2000000 and multiply of 32)
4. The auto tuning for the round sieve percentage can be also disabled by specifying a fixed value for the primorialMultiplier with the '-m' parameter (must be between 5 - 1009 and should be a prime number)

I intentionally left out these new parameters from the help because these are intended for more advanced users.
https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/1189851/jhPrimeminer-GMP-v7.zip
I won't post the AVX version because I think it has no performance gain. In case somebody saw any improvement with AVX let me know.

And later in the same thread:
Quote
to compare numbers:

v4 has 41 blocks found and 409 primecoins credited to the account.
--basically even with solo mining if i add the donation to the total

v6 has 51 blocks found and 370 credited to the account
--obviously this version is MUCH better at finding blocks and better for the pool over all. unfortunately, the share handling is killing this miner's profit potential.

Strictly speaking, the highlighted can be put under doubt. Standard deviation for 46 found blocks is about 0.5*sqrt(46) = 3.39. For 99.7% confidence interval it's 3*SD = 10.17, so the two values are within error. Need some more testing.

08/11/13 - 11:56:25 - SHARE FOUND !!! (Th#: 0) ---  DIFF: 7.195531 - VAL: 1.000
   >7
Invalid share
Reason: Share data time overflow

Edit:

Fixed

[18:18] MarcoPolo: i have seen Share data time overflow before. i have a machine mining with a bad cmos battery. so sometimes it looses its time settings. update the time to the correct date and time and it should be gone after a miner restart
